Post-it Note Love
WDOK Relationship expert Mildred Pardington "Party" Fitzsimmons offered some St. Valentine's Day advice to a listener who is in the doghouse with his wife. She recommends anyone who needs to repair a relationship use post-it notes to do it. Lots of post-it notes.
Put them everywhere. What to write? Here's a sample list:
In the oven..."thinking of you makes me hot"
In the freezer..."only you can thaw my frozen heart"
On the mirror..."reflecting on it, you are the most important person in my life"
On the cereal box..." from your serial lover"
In their shoes..."you are the only person I want to walk through life with"
In the shower..."thinking of you steams me up
In the car..."you drive me crazy"
On the phone..."speaking of love, you are my one and only"
In the toilet tank..."you float my boat"
On the sugar bowl..."no one is sweeter than you"
On the milk bottle..."I will pour all my love on you"
On a jacket..."you suit me just fine"
In a jewelry box..."your love is worth solid gold"
In the baby's diaper..."you've got me coming and going"
